And the ego-intelligence function then. By this I mean a centralized organizing factor such as government. Ponder this for a second;
Are you familiar with the concept of emergence(not emergency)?. Emergence is a phenomenon that happens when many small "stupid" parts, together form an intelligent system, without any of the parts being in control, or even knowing the structure of the whole. Take an ant-farm for example. No one ant - not even the queen - has any idea how the colony works. Yet it does, with military precision. So what happens is that the system becomes transcendent over its parts. Ebay is another example. Instead of having one ego-intelligence judging the credibility of all sellers and the validity of all buyers, which would be monstrously ineffective, they instead installed a rating system by which the system became self-regulatory. So no one controls the market, because the market in-it-self does a better job than any one intelligence could.

Now call me a romantic, but if ants could do it... why shouldn't we be able to? Obviously our situation requires a much more sophisticated system, but the principle is nevertheless sound. We mistake ourselves when we talk of which government is best, when we should at least strife to become a naturally self-regulatory system. This is not anarchy, mind you. There is method to this madness , just that we together, when letting go of trying to control the system, become a system that transcends the intelligence of our individuality.
